The university Tower will shine with a burnt orange glow Thursday, Sept. 17, in honor of the Presidential Inauguration of Gregory L. Fenves. To recognize his role as the 29th president of The University of Texas at Austin, the Tower’s windows will be lit to display “29.”

Fenves began serving as president on June 3. He previously served as UT Austin’s provost and executive vice president since 2013. Fenves is a member of the National Academy of Engineering, the highest national honor awarded to engineers in the United States. Prior to being named provost, Fenves served for five years as dean of UT Austin’s Cockrell School of Engineering.
